PUD-002592-2025 (Planned Unit Development) is a major amendment to PUD-50 on 0.64 acres which is currently platted as Lot 7, Block 1 of the Brentwood Center addition. The property is located just south of Washington Street (91st Street) and just west of Aspen Place (145th East Avenue).
This amendment is intended to facilitate site plan approval of an expansion to an existing building on site. During the site plan review process a parking requirement of 1 parking space per 200 sq. ft. of building space was identified. This would have required 29 parking spaces for the existing building and proposed expansion; however, the site can only accommodate 12. Parking requirements under current code require “Office, business, or professional” uses to have 1 parking space per 350 sq. ft. which would require the existing building and proposed expansion to have 17 spaces. The applicant is requesting to change this parking ratio from 1 parking space per 200 sq. ft. of building floor area to 1 parking space per 525 sq. ft. of building.
The applicant is also requesting to remove the fire lane standards within PUD-50 in favor of modern fire lane regulations. Any fire lane or other fire safety aspect of the site plan will be reviewed and approved by the Broken Arrow Fire Marshal. There were no objections from the fire marshal to this change.
The applicant is also requesting to remove the requirement of Bradford pear trees along the rear of the property in favor of current landscaping buffer standards. Bradford pear trees are no longer on the list of accepted trees in the current Broken Arrow landscaping regulations.

According to FEMA National Flood Hazard Layer Maps, no portion of this property is located within the 100-year floodplain. Water and Sanitary Sewer are available from the City of Broken Arrow.

Recommendation:
Based on the location of the property and surrounding land uses, Staff recommends PUD-002592-2025 (Planned Unit Development) be recommended to the Broken Arrow City Council for approval.
